Popped and poured; enjoyed over lunch at Buvette. Deep ruby color with a transparent core; medium viscosity with moderate staining of the tears and some slight signs of sediment. On the nose, the wine is developing with notes of funky-fresh tart cherries, some horse stable, blackberries, pomegranate, river rocks. On the palate the wine is dry with medium tannin and medium+ acid. Confirming the notes from the nose. The finish is medium+ with some grippy minerals. Lovely with lunch! Drink now through 2032.

I am a novice to Spanish wines and Mencia as a varietal but the instantly impressive balance and freshness of this wine was very appealing. Tasting somewhere in between a bordeaux cabernet and a northern rhône syrah, this wine paired brilliantly with the mediterranean/middle eastern cuisine at LA’s Saffy’s restaurant. Overall: 92.

Softer, less spicy and more elegant than the La Vitoriana, still with notable oak aromas. Needs time.
